The Core of Manchester United's Sports Medicine: The Team

Alright, let's get down to the nitty-gritty and introduce you to the unsung heroes – the Manchester United sports medicine team. These are the folks who work relentlessly to ensure the players are fit, healthy, and ready to compete. The department is a multi-disciplinary team, meaning they bring together a variety of specialists. It's like a well-oiled machine, where each member plays a vital role in the overall health and performance of the players. The team typically includes:

  • Team Doctors: These are the primary medical professionals, overseeing all medical aspects, from initial assessments to treatment plans and long-term health management. They're the go-to people for everything medical.
  • Physiotherapists: Physiotherapists are experts in injury rehabilitation and prevention. They use a range of techniques, like exercise, manual therapy, and electrotherapy, to help players recover from injuries and improve their physical function.
  • Sports Scientists: They analyze player performance, design training programs, and monitor player fatigue. Their insights are crucial for optimizing training and minimizing the risk of injury. They use data and cutting-edge technology to gain a deeper understanding of the players’ physical demands.
  • Strength and Conditioning Coaches: These coaches are responsible for developing players’ strength, power, and endurance. They design and implement specific training programs tailored to each player's needs, helping them build the physical foundation required for the demands of professional football.
  • Nutritionists: Nutritionists play a vital role in optimizing players' diets to support their training and recovery. They help players understand the importance of fueling their bodies with the right nutrients to maximize performance and health. They create personalized meal plans that meet the unique needs of each player.

Each member of the Manchester United sports medicine team brings unique expertise to the table, creating a holistic approach to player care. Their combined efforts ensure players are not only treated when injured but also educated and supported to maintain optimal health and performance throughout the season. They all work in close collaboration with the coaches and other members of the technical staff. It’s all about creating a supportive environment where the players can thrive.

Injury Prevention: The Proactive Approach of Manchester United

Prevention is always better than cure, right? The Manchester United sports medicine department understands this perfectly. That's why a significant portion of their focus is on preventing injuries before they even happen. It’s all about creating a proactive strategy to keep the players on the pitch and away from the treatment table.

One of the key strategies is comprehensive screening. Before the season even begins, players undergo rigorous medical examinations and physical assessments. This helps the medical team identify any potential vulnerabilities, imbalances, or pre-existing conditions that might increase the risk of injury. It's like a health checkup, but supercharged for elite athletes!

Personalized training programs are also crucial. The sports scientists and strength and conditioning coaches work closely with each player to develop tailored training regimes. These programs focus on strengthening specific muscle groups, improving flexibility, and addressing any identified weaknesses. This approach ensures that each player is prepared for the unique demands of their position and playing style.

Proper warm-ups and cool-downs are non-negotiable. Before every training session and match, players engage in carefully designed warm-up routines to prepare their bodies for the physical stress. Similarly, cool-down routines after training and matches help to promote recovery and reduce muscle soreness. This helps players to have a good recovery time.

Regular monitoring is also essential. The medical team continuously monitors player fatigue levels, training loads, and other relevant factors. This allows them to identify any signs of overtraining or increased injury risk. By constantly analyzing data and paying close attention to the players' physical condition, the team can make timely adjustments to training schedules and prevent potential problems. Injury prevention is a continuous process, always evolving and adapting to the players' needs.

Injury Treatment and Rehabilitation at Manchester United: Getting Back on the Pitch

When injuries inevitably occur (because, let’s face it, it's football!), the Manchester United sports medicine team kicks into high gear. They utilize a comprehensive approach to diagnose, treat, and rehabilitate injuries, ensuring players can return to the pitch as quickly and safely as possible. It is all about rapid and effective recovery so the players can show their A-game in every match.

Accurate diagnosis is the first step. The team uses advanced imaging techniques, such as MRI scans and X-rays, to accurately assess the extent of the injury. This allows them to develop a precise treatment plan, tailored to the specific injury and the individual player's needs.

Treatment plans vary depending on the nature and severity of the injury. They may include medication, injections, manual therapy, and other interventions. The goal is to reduce pain, inflammation, and promote healing. The medical team always keeps the players well-informed about their treatment options and encourages their active participation in the recovery process.

Rehabilitation is a critical phase. Once the initial pain and inflammation are controlled, the physiotherapists and strength and conditioning coaches work with the players to restore their strength, flexibility, and range of motion. This involves a carefully structured program of exercises and progressive training. Players gradually increase the intensity and complexity of their training as they recover.

Return-to-play protocols are strictly followed. Before a player is cleared to return to competitive play, they must pass a series of tests and assessments. These tests evaluate their physical readiness and ensure they can safely perform at the required level. The medical team works closely with the coaching staff to ensure a smooth transition back into the team environment. Every step of the process is carefully monitored, to make sure the players are ready to take on the challenge on the field.

The Role of Technology in Manchester United's Sports Medicine

Technology plays a HUGE role in the Manchester United sports medicine department. It is about staying ahead of the game and using cutting-edge tools to enhance player care and performance. They are constantly looking for innovative ways to leverage technology to improve their processes.

Data analytics are a game-changer. The team uses sophisticated software to collect and analyze data from various sources, including GPS tracking systems, wearable sensors, and performance metrics. This data provides valuable insights into player workloads, fatigue levels, and movement patterns. By analyzing this information, the medical team can identify potential injury risks and optimize training programs.

Wearable technology is also widely used. Players wear devices that track their heart rate, acceleration, and other vital signs. This data helps the medical team monitor player exertion during training and matches. It allows for personalized adjustments to training programs and helps prevent overtraining and potential injuries.

Advanced imaging techniques, such as MRI and ultrasound, are crucial for accurate diagnosis. These technologies provide detailed images of the player's internal structures, allowing the medical team to identify injuries early and develop appropriate treatment plans. The use of technology is a constant evolution.

Virtual reality (VR) is increasingly used for rehabilitation. VR can create immersive environments that simulate real-game scenarios. This helps players to regain their confidence and improve their skills after an injury. The use of technology allows Manchester United to refine the player's performance on the field.

Nutrition and Diet: Fueling the Champions

Good nutrition is absolutely critical for elite athletes, and Manchester United sports medicine prioritizes this aspect. The club's nutritionists work closely with the players to develop personalized meal plans that optimize their performance and promote their overall health. It is like the engine of the car. If the car does not have the right engine the performance will be bad.

Players' dietary needs vary depending on their individual requirements, training load, and playing position. The nutritionists take these factors into account when creating personalized meal plans. These plans are designed to ensure players consume the right amount of calories, macronutrients (proteins, carbohydrates, and fats), and micronutrients (vitamins and minerals). It is all about building a good foundation.

Hydration is also a key focus. Players are educated on the importance of staying hydrated, especially during training and matches. The nutritionists advise players on the best way to maintain optimal hydration levels. Hydration is key to success on the field.

Supplementation, when necessary, is carefully managed. The nutritionists work with the players to determine if they need to take any supplements to support their training and recovery. Only supplements that are approved and safe for use are considered. They avoid anything that may negatively impact performance.

Education is crucial. The nutritionists conduct regular sessions to educate players on the importance of good nutrition. They provide guidance on food choices, meal preparation, and healthy eating habits. The education provides the proper knowledge on what the players need to eat.
